Stillen Revaluation – Preferential treatment of homegrown new drugs
The maximum price cut rate for PVA adjusted to 12.5%
Essential medicines made with domestic raw materials will also be favored

The new drug pricing system in 2025 is expected to be volatile due to Korea’s political turmoil.

 

Whether the external reference pricing reevaluations and re-evaluation of the listed PE exemption drugs, which were reviewed or discussed last year, will be carried out this year is also the focus of attention.

 

However, as most of the detailed measures for 'Reflecting the Innovative Value of New Drugs and Improving the Drug Pricing System for Health Security' have been revised, the revisions are expected to be implemented in earnest this year.

 

In particular, the partial revision of the 'Criteria for the Determination and Adjustment of Drugs (administrative notice issued in October 2024), which contains the most relevant contents, is likely to be applied before March, and it is expected that the preferential measures for homegrown new drugs will be applied this year.

 

Dailypharm has collected the drug pricing policies and systems that will be applied this year, which are as follows.

 

2025 Drug Reimbursement Adequacy Reevaluations The drug reimbursement adequacy reevaluations that began in 2020 will continue this year.

 

This year, 8 ingredients will be subject to review: olopatadine hydrochloride; clematis root-trichosanthis radix-prunella vulgaris L; bepotastine; spherical absorptive carbon; artemisia princeps leaf extract; l-Ornithine-l-Asparate; sulglycotide; and chenodeoxycholic acid-ursodeoxycholic acid trihydrate magnesium salt.

 

Among them, the 3-year average claims amount for the artemisia princeps leaf extract has been the highest at KRW 112.5 billion, so the outcome of the reevaluation is expected to be of interest.

 

There are 142 artemisia princeps leaf extracts listed on the reimbursement list, including Dong-A ST’s original, Stillen Tab.

 

If the reimbursement adequacy for the ingredient is not recognized in this year's reevaluations, it is expected to hit the relevant pharmaceutical companies hard.

 

In particular, the artemisia princeps leaf extract is also undergoing MFDS’s bioequivalence reevaluations, so the reimbursement adequacy reevaluations will have a further impact.

 

In addition, the results of the reimbursement of olopatadine hydrochloride, worth KRW 66.4 billion, and bepotastine, worth KRW 54.8 billion, are also gaining attention.

 

The reimbursement adequacy reevaluations are expected to begin in earnest in March after the Health Insurance Review and Assessment Service report at the beginning of the year.

 

Price-Voume Agreement system’s maximum reduction rate raised to 12.5% In October last year, the Ministry of Health and Welfare announced a partial amendment to the 'Criteria for Determining and Adjusting Drug Prices' to raise the maximum reduction rate for drugs subject to PVA negotiations from 10% to 15%.

 

However, the adjustment rate stays at the 12.5% level until December 31, 2025, which is a lower rate, given the early stage of its implementation.

 

Therefore, the maximum reduction rate of 12.5% is expected to be applied upon the notification of the amendment this year.

 

As the maximum reduction rate is 2.5% higher than the current 10%, the intensity of losses the companies will bear due to drug price cuts is expected to be greater.   Preferential treatment for homegrown new drugs developed by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ical company Similarly, if the amendments to the 'Criteria for Determining and Adjusting Drug Prices' are promulgated, preferential drug pricing for domestically developed new drugs will also be then applied.

 

In particular, non-inferior new drugs by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ical Companies will be priced at the ‘lower of the highest price of the upper limit of alternative drugs or the amount added to the weighted average price of substitute drugs (X100/53.55, approximately 1.8 times).’ This is expected to be significantly higher than the current price, which is set below the weighted average price of alternative drugs, resulting in higher profit margins for drugs covered by the proposal.

 

It will be interesting to see if Shinpoong Pharmaceutical's 'Hyal Flex Inj' will receive preferential treatment.

 

On the other hand, homegrown new drugs will be able to apply the dual pricing system when negotiating their price, paving the way for them to enter overseas markets at higher prices.

 

Preferential measures for national essential medicines that use domestic raw materials In addition to the preferential plan for homegrown new drugs, a preferential plan for national essential medicines that use domestic ingredients will also be established.

 

It will also be applied when some amendments to the MOHW’s 'Standards for Determination and Adjustment of Pharmaceuticals' are published.

 

Specifically, it has been decided that nationally essential medicines that use domestic raw materials will be considered to have met all the criteria for preferential pricing.

 

In addition, a (68/53.55 - 1)×100% premium will be added to the calculated amount, which would render the price of eligible drugs higher than now.

 

The government expects this to increase the domestic self-sufficiency rate of national essential medicines.

 

Designation of 7 new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ical Companies Designation as a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ical Company serves as the basis for premium pricing during drug reimbursement listings.

 

Therefore, the ‘innovative’ title is directly linked to profits.

 

This year, Dong-A ST, Amgen Korea, Onconic Therapeutics, Curocell, Hahnall Biopharma, SK Bioscience, and SK Biopharm were newly designated, bringing the total to 49 companies recognized as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ical Companies.

 

On the other hand, as 4 pharmaceutical companies were eliminated during the recertification process for Korea Innovative Pharmaceutical Companies in June last year, they will unable to receive incentives such as drug pricing premiums that they had been previously granted as existing innovative pharmaceutical companies.

 

The government plans to improve the criteria for the decertification of innovative pharmaceutical companies this year.

 

In particular, it is expected to ease the certification requirements for rebates.

 

New subjects added for prescreening for reimbursement benefits The government has recently been actively adjusting the drugs that are subject to pre-review for reimbursement benefits, and last year, reimbursement of Strensiq Inj and Soliris-Ultomiris for the PNH (paroxysmal nocturnal hemoglobinuria) indication was converted to general review.

 

As of this month, Ultomiris for the atypical hemolytic uremic syndrome indication will require prior authorizations.

 

Soliris had been the drug that required prior authorizations in the atypical hemolytic uremic syndrome category, which has been controversial due to its low prior authorization rate.

 

Therefore, it will be interesting to see if the addition of Ultomiris will change the landscape.

 

As a result, Soliris, Ultomiris, Spinraza, Zolgensma, Crysvita, Evrysdi, and Luxturna, and drugs used for immune tolerance therapy must pass prior authorization to be reimbursed.
